McCain Has Terse Response on Palin Shopping Spree
By THE ASSOCIATED PRESS
Published: October 23, 2008
Filed at 12:12 p.m. ET
ORMOND BEACH, Fla. (AP) — Presidential candidate John McCain isn’t happy about having to explain why the Republican Party has had to buy running mate Sarah Palin $150,000 in clothes, hair styling and accessories.
McCain was asked several questions on Thursday about the shopping spree — and he answered each one more or less the same way: Palin needed clothes and they’ll be donated to charity.
McCain offered no further comment, except to say that the Republican National Committee doesn’t buy his clothes.
News of the purchases, largely from upscale Saks Fifth Avenue and Neiman Marcus, contrasts with the image Palin has crafted as a typical hockey mom.
Asked Wednesday who had paid for the suit he was wearing, Democratic vice presidential candidate Joe Biden told WSLS-TV in Roanoke, Va.: ‘’I pay for my suits. I pay for all of my own clothing.'’
